### "Trustworthy high value freight transactions."

January 15, 2026

5.0

This is a nightmare industry to get a chargeback on a coast-to-coast transport job. I rely on this gateway since it is solid secure. It can cope with our day-to-day traffic without stuttering despite the arrangement having a retro feel to the early internet days compared to today’s contenders.

Pros

The fraud detecting package makes me feel comfortable when handling large credit card payments done by new shippers I have never done business with before.

Cons

The user interface is so outdated, and it is impossible to navigate through the backend settings with the required number of clicks. The monthly gateway charges are accumulated within a short period even in months when our transaction volume is low.

### "Holds Funds like PayPal Does - Avoid. "

December 3, 2019

2.0

I'm not saying that Authorize.net does not work for everybody. But the digital marketer is in particular I would steer clear because it has the same issues that PayPal exhibits were sometimes a hold your funds for no reason and you have to fight to get them. Youre flagged as high risk I was a customer with Authorize.net for about three months and I was approved for ACH bank transfers by their credit team. I put two of them through and all of a sudden my bank transfer account was shut down and they didn't tell me why other than my account was deemed high-risk by their bank and no matter what I did it would never be reopened ever. To my knowledge the only thing that makes it high-risk is that I charged about $5k in two days - Which I told the underwriter team was my norm before I signed up. They knew how much money I would be processing each month. They also told me that my business model wasn't elibigile for bank transfers. My clients couldn't even ask for a refund. All they could do was dispute the charges that were on hold and if they did that it would hurt my account and my credit. To this day they still have about $4400 of my money that I will not get until the end of January if my account is in good standing. Well I shut down the account and moved over to QuickBooks so hopefully I get paid. Again I'm doing recurring bank transfers with my client so this might not be the case for everybody and this might be great for credit card transactions.

Pros

It was very easy to set up recurring payments and sync with my webmaster.

Cons

\- The UI is extremely outdated and looks like it's from the early 2000s. - Your invoices are not customizable and they look tacky - Navigating around the menu is not user-friendly as finding where you're trying to go and can be difficult - Customer support is not the greatest and sometimes I can't help you with your problems or get back to you in a timely matter

### "It's been great for our business"

November 26, 2018

5.0

Authorize.net has been super simple and straight forward to use. I've been able to cancel a charge that was made in error before it even hit a card. I get full details of who is purchasing and how much. I can look up transactions easily. It's been a great second backup system for us as far as credit card records. It's been very easy to implement on our website and we've been very happy.

Pros

I have loved using Authorize.net. Often I have to go back thru our credit card records to check how much was charged or how much was refunded. It's great to be able to look up via credit card number or names. Customer service has always been excellent whenever I've needed to contact them. I also like that I'm able to run reports of all of our transactions when I'm trying to compartmentalized different amounts and categories. It works well with our registration system.

Cons

I wish that we were able to issue refunds after the 3 month period. I know we can lose some of our security measures to allow our system to automatically refund but we don't want to do that. Instead we take the cc number and manually enter it into a different refund system for those return that are past 3 months. I think the security issue is a mandated issue and there is not much Authorize can do. I do wish the downloads went to a simpler to read excel format but I tend to take the CSV file and do what I need to do to make it work.
